Minister Rossen Jeliazkov met with the President of Confederation of Independent Trade Unions in Bulgaria (CITUB) Plamen Dimitrov and Petar Bunev, the chairman of Syndicate of Railway Undertakers in Bulgaria

Minister Jeliazkov presented to the trade union leaders the development policies in the Transport sector and the projects currently under way. During the discussion were discussed also topical issues related to the state and development of Bulgarian State Railways and Bulgarian Posts.

According to Rossen Jeliazkov, it is of utmost importance to maintain a permanent dialogue with the trade unions, who have a direct view of the processes, both in transport and in communications. "The pursuit of sensible modern policies will speed up the reorganization processes of these companies, which in turn will contribute to the sustainable growth of the country's economy."

Representatives of one of the largest trade union organizations have expressed their readiness to support the leadership of the Ministry of Transport, Information Technology and Communications in addressing topical issues.
